`
lisanping
  • 浏览: 146091 次
  • 性别: Icon_minigender_1
  • 来自: 北京
社区版块
存档分类
最新评论
文章列表

python的序列

python的序列包括列表,元组,字符串.1.取单个项目与数组的下标差不多,不同的是它的索引可以为负数,list[-1]是允许的,可以看作是list[list长度-index]2.取切片用:号格开,list[:3],当然,索引同样可以用负数.

对象引用

想要复制一个列表或者类似的序列或者其他复杂的对象(不是如整数那样的简单对象 ),那么你必须使用切片操作符来取得拷贝。

python的函数

函数是可重用的程序块。允许你给一块语句一个名称,然后你可以在你的程序的任何地方使用这个名称任意多次地运行这个语句块。这被称为 调用 函数。python的函数是def定义的。def关键字后跟一个函数的标识符名称,然后跟一对圆括号。圆括号之中可以包括一些变量名,该行以冒号结尾。接下来是一块语句,它们是函数体。 引用内容def sayHello():           print 'Hello World!' # 函数体sayHello() # 函数调用

''和“”

[supern@localhost ~]$ a=aaa[supern@localhost ~]$ echo $aaaa[supern@localhost ~]$ echo '$a'$a[supern@localhost ~]$ echo "$a"aaa[supern@localhost ~]$ echo '"$a"'"$a"[supern@localhost ~]$ echo "'$a'"'aaa'[supern@localhost ~]$‘’关闭了,而“”没有。优先级从外到内。

文件系统的挂载

1.卸载不掉fuser <挂载点>查看哪个进程号正在使用该设备,结合ps aux应该能解决问题(注:-f虽然是强制卸载的含义,但只是针对nfs设计的)2.vfat文件系统由于vfat文件系统分长文件名和短文件名所以,-o shortname=winnt使其与win xp/2k一致3.自动挂载HAL和autofsHAL:etc/dbus-1/system.d/hal.conf中的policyautofs:/etc/auto.misc,/etc/auto.masterGnome:gconf-editorsysterm-->storage-->default_options-- ...
困扰几天的无声问题总算有解了T2000声卡模块在ALSA驱动下,在external amplifier开启的情况下默认用此作为输出,从而主音量失效。所以,#alsamixer进入alsamixer,往右选择到external amplifier,将此项静音(按m键),这时应该在声卡检测里可以出声音了。
wc l file wc -w file wc -c file: 分别计算文件的行数(line)、单词数(word)和字符数(character)grep 'pattern' file: 在文件内搜索字符串或和正则表达式匹配的字符串 cut  -b column file:从文件中的某一行切割出指定的部分并写到 ...
工具:automake/autocof/m4/libtool/perl 流程:

关于grub

计算机启动,先是固化的CMOS上电自检,然后加载第一个可启动磁盘的MBR上的boot loader程序(一般在启动盘的第一个物理扇区,占446字节),然后把控制权交给Boot Loader,由Boot Loader进一步完成操作系统内核的加载。当Boot Loader找到内核之后,就把控制权交给操作系统内核,由内核继续完成系统的启动。Boot Loader主要有LiLo、GRUB以及Windows下的MBR程序。grub流程:开机-->CMOS--->MBR(stage1,判断是否是grub,如果是--->stage1.5,加载设备映像文件(device.map)和菜单背景图像 ...

shell参数

在shell中,表示值是用$,相当于DOS中的%。1.位置参数一般是系统或用户提供的参数。$[0-n],$0,表示指令本身,$1表示第一个参数,一次类推。$0是内部参数,必须要有的,其后的就可有可无了2.内部参数$# ----参数数目$? ----上一个代码或者shell程序在shell中退出的情况,如果正常退出则返回0,反之为非0值。$* ----所有参数的字符串
今天装freebsd的时候把密码全忘记了,怎么试都不对劲,最后找了个比较好的办法。进单用户模式键入指令:boot -s# fsck -p# mount -a# passwd root(或者其他用户)# exit

JAVA1.5新特性

    博客分类:
  • JAVA
今天看代码发现有很多看不懂的写法,问下张海才知道是JAVA1.5的新特性,于是上网找了下,了解到1.5的新特性: 1.泛型.   新引进的重头,有点像C++的模板. 泛型是方便对集合的操作,省去复杂的类型转换. import java.util.*;      Array ...
我的ubuntu新内核2.6.21.5编译成功 现在来分享下步骤: step 1 准备工作 安装需要的工具:  build-essential   基本的编程库(gcc, make等)  kernel-package   libncurses5-dev  (meke menuconfig要调用的)  libqt3-headers   (make xconfig要调用的) 其他工具在升级过程中可以按提示安装 step 2 下载源代码 url: http://www.kernel.org wget最新的代码到/usr/src下,并tar -jxf解压缩 再创建一个ln -s文件linux,方 ...
linun启动顺序:poweron -->bios自检-->lilo/grub调用-->kernel 调用(vmlinuz-->initrd-img-->)-->init***-->miggetty-->logininit调用其配置文件/etc/inttab;inittab从上到下按顺序启动,调用rc.sysinit ---rc?.d(rc?.d下的文件都是init.d下的符号链接)---其中有一个xinetd的超级进程---调用/etc/xinetd.conf配置文件---从配置文件中知道读/etc/xinetd.d文件----结束后调用migg ...
1.掌握至少50个以上的常用命令。2.熟悉Gnome/KDE等X-windows桌面环境操作。3.掌握.tgz、.rpm等软件包的常用安装方法4.学习添加外设,安装设备驱动程序(比如网卡)5.熟悉Grub/Lilo引导器及简单的修复操作。6.熟悉Linux文件系统?和目录结构。7.掌握vi,gcc,gdb等常用编辑器,编译器,调试器?。8.理解shell别名、管道、I/O重定向、输入和输出以及shell脚本编程。9.学习Linux环境下的组网。 
Global site tag (gtag.js) - Google Analytics